Subject: First-Aid Room Access

Hello and welcome to Thornewell Labs. The first-aid room is on the ground floor beside the post room, open at all times. Supplies are restocked weekly; please log anything you use in the folder by the door. The door stays locked outside reception hours and opens with the code below.

door code, yagap-bahof: bdg-O-05

## Changelog — Driftwell Reports 4.2.0

Changed defaults for timezone handling in report exports. Exports now render in tenant-local time instead of UTC. Daily export cutoff is computed per-tenant, so two tenants may receive the "same day" report at different wall-clock times. Legacy UTC behavior remains available via override. Maintainers: audit any downstream jobs that parsed export timestamps assuming UTC. New defaults shipped with this release are as follows.

deployment values, taweg-bajop:
[fenvan]
port = 5672
team = holmir
host = fenvan.orvexio.example
region = lower-1
access_code = ac_b98bc6
timeout_ms = 1500

Subject: DR drill — Gatecount turnstile counter

Team, next Thursday we run the quarterly disaster-recovery drill for Gatecount, the stadium turnstile counter at Vellmore Arena. We'll fail over the ingest nodes and replay one hour of entry events. Expect dashboards to show stale totals during the window. If the standby node asks you to unseal its local store, enter the drill recovery passphrase, reproduced here for convenience:

vault phrase of bagaf-kajeg = jorath-feniel-briir-siliel-ralix

Subject: PickPath Optimizer 3.2 — release candidate

Team,

RC for PickPath Optimizer 3.2 is cut. Changes since 3.1: removed the legacy SOAP bridge, pinned all third-party deps, dropped write access to the routing cache from the worker role. No new network listeners. Scan results attached to the ticket; zero criticals, two informational findings accepted by the Hollow Pine warehouse ops group. Security review window closes Thursday. Artifacts are reproducible from the tagged commit. Verify against the token below.

session token of tajef-bageg = htk21_5d90d574934f3ccae6437